Course Objective and Content

Course Objectives:
The general objective of this course is to improve the statistical literacy, to make sense of researches using statistical processes and to help those who use statistics in their research.
Course Content: Basic concepts of statistics and application of basic concepts to education, parametric and nonparametric techniques used in social sciences, Teaching these techniques using SPSS program

Lesson Plan

Week Subject Related Preparation
1) Basic concepts, the place of statistics in research process, variable, measurement, scale, data and statistics concepts İ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
2) Introduction to SPSS, creating a data file in SPSS İ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
3) Descriptive statistics, frequency distribution, calculation and presentation of frequency distribution with table, calculation of frequency distribution with graphics İ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
4) Central tendency and variability measures, central tendency measurements, arithmetic mean, median (median), peak value (mode), variability measures İ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
5) Procedural statistics, estimation of the universe value, normal distribution curve, hypothesis testing İ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
6) Analysis of differences, T test, Independent groups t test İ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
7) Midterm
8) Paired groups t test İ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
9) Variance analysis, One way variance analysis İ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
10) Analysis of variance for repeated measurements İ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
11) Covariance analysis İ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
12) Covariance analysis İ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
13) Relationship analysis İ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
14) Chi-square İlgili kaynaklardan araştırma yaparak, farklı örnekleri inceleme
15) Final exam
